Transaction d21893890a5b8742353fc9de4a628cc054bd2a65d9c8f4e69e01e252e68ce990
1 Input
1 Output
-
d21893890a5b8742353fc9de4a628cc054bd2a65d9c8f4e69e01e252e68ce990:0
- value
- 188606
- script pubkey
- OP_0 OP_PUSHBYTES_32 b7666b6f5be4a1c5ad2dd51f8eea2dffc1f486725a68cc37bca566c6eb186005
- address
- bc1qkanxkm6mujsuttfd650ca63dllqlfpnjtf5vcdau54nvd6ccvqzs46gkh2